Black nitrile gloves are made from synthetic rubber called nitrile. Unlike traditional latex gloves, these gloves are latex-free, making them an excellent alternative for individuals with latex allergies. The black color not only adds a sleek appearance but also has practical benefits, including hiding stains and providing a professional look.
Before diving into specific uses, it’s essential to highlight some key attributes that make black nitrile gloves stand out:
Chemical Resistance: Nitrile gloves offer superior protection against a variety of chemicals, oils, and solvents, making them ideal for tasks that involve exposure to hazardous substances.
Tear and Puncture Resistance: These gloves are more resistant to tears and punctures compared to their latex counterparts, ensuring added safety while working with sharp objects.
Comfort and Flexibility: Despite their strength, nitrile gloves provide excellent dexterity and fit, allowing users to perform tasks that require precision.
Versatile Use: Suitable for multiple industries, these gloves are highly versatile, making them a go-to option for various applications.
In hospitals and clinics, black nitrile gloves are frequently used by healthcare professionals for procedures that require a high level of hygiene. Their ability to provide a barrier against bodily fluids and contaminants makes them an essential part of infection control protocols.
Mechanics and automotive technicians love black nitrile gloves for their resistance to oils and greases. They offer protection against harsh chemicals found in automotive work, allowing professionals to maintain their grip while keeping their hands clean.
In the food industry, maintaining hygiene is paramount. Black nitrile gloves are commonly used by chefs and food handlers, as they resist punctures and keep hands safe from cross-contamination while preparing and serving food.
Beauty professionals, including hairdressers and estheticians, use black nitrile gloves to maintain cleanliness during procedures. Tattoo artists favor them for their non-latex composition and the professional appearance they convey, ensuring clients feel safer during their body art experience.
Cleaning staff often wear black nitrile gloves to protect their hands from harsh chemicals found in cleaning products. Their durability ensures that cleaning tasks can be performed efficiently without the worry of glove tears or leaks.
In industrial environments, these gloves safeguard workers from heavy-duty tasks. They are used widely in construction, logistics, and manufacturing, where exposure to hazardous materials is common.
